查看: 16768|回复: 5

MACcms通杀型后台拿shell

[复制链接]
  • TA的每日心情

    2024-11-13 20:06
  • 签到天数: 1628 天

    [LV.Master]伴坛终老

    发表于 2015-9-17 00:40:04 | 显示全部楼层 |阅读模式
    90sec@Joseph

    此漏洞的缘由是来自论坛的一哥们求助拿shell才无奈的去审计
    QQ截图20150916205504.png
    看见这个模块编辑就总感觉有漏洞存在当然这里并没有想象的那么简单,咱们之前遇到的模版编辑漏洞已经在这个版本修复了
    漏洞文件:
    [PHP] 纯文本查看 复制代码
    elseif($method=='save')
    {
        $path = be('post','path'); $path = str_replace('\\','/',$path);
        $file =  be('post','file'); $file = str_replace('\\','/',$file);
        $filename = be('post','filename');
        $suffix = be('post','suffix');
        $filecontent =  stripslashes(be('post','filecontent'));
        if(isN($path)){
            if (substring($file,11)!='../template' || count( explode('../',$file) ) > 2) {
                showErr('System','非法目录请求');
                return;
            }
            if(!file_exists($file)){
                showErr('System','非法文件请求');
                return;
            }
            fwrite(fopen($file.$suffix,'wb'),$filecontent);
        }
        else{
            if (substring($path,11)!='../template' || count( explode('../',$path) ) > 2) {
                showErr('System','非法目录请求');
                return;
            }
            $extarr = array('.html','.htm','.js','.xml','.wml');
            if(!in_array($suffix,$extarr)){
                $suffix='.html';
            }
             
            fwrite(fopen($path.'/'.$filename.$suffix,'wb'),$filecontent);
        }
        showMsg('文件内容保存完毕','');
    }

    获取自定义的文件名和内容和路径然后一个if判断path是否为空,如果为空则进入漏洞,不为空则没有漏洞
    所以这里burp抓包把path的值给清楚了,然后添加这个suffix参数为我们想要的文件名
    20150916210046.png
    20150916210203.png

    评分

    参与人数 3i币 +20 收起 理由
    丨丶钟情 + 5 支持原创
    Linda + 10 感谢分享
    蓝颜 + 5 支持原创

    查看全部评分

    相关帖子

    回复

    使用道具 举报

    该用户从未签到

    发表于 2015-9-17 06:00:26 | 显示全部楼层
    还是不错的哦,顶了
    回复 支持 反对

    使用道具 举报

  • TA的每日心情
    无聊
    2023-4-26 23:35
  • 签到天数: 237 天

    [LV.7]常住居民III

    发表于 2015-9-17 08:56:38 | 显示全部楼层
    谢谢分享               
    回复 支持 反对

    使用道具 举报

    该用户从未签到

    发表于 2015-9-17 18:59:57 | 显示全部楼层
    支持中国红客联盟(ihonker.org)
    回复 支持 反对

    使用道具 举报

  • TA的每日心情
    开心
    2022-10-21 10:32
  • 签到天数: 11 天

    [LV.3]偶尔看看II

    发表于 2015-9-18 05:15:00 | 显示全部楼层
    学习学习技术,加油!
    回复 支持 反对

    使用道具 举报

    该用户从未签到

    发表于 2015-9-18 17:13:02 | 显示全部楼层
    学习学习技术,加油!
    回复 支持 反对

    使用道具 举报

    您需要登录后才可以回帖 登录 | 注册

    本版积分规则

    指导单位

    江苏省公安厅

    江苏省通信管理局

    浙江省台州刑侦支队

    DEFCON GROUP 86025

    旗下站点

    邮箱系统

    应急响应中心

    红盟安全

    联系我们

    官方QQ群:112851260

    官方邮箱:security#ihonker.org(#改成@)

    官方核心成员

    Archiver|手机版|小黑屋| ( 苏ICP备2021031567号 )

    GMT+8, 2024-11-22 14:52 , Processed in 0.041426 second(s), 14 queries , Gzip On, MemCache On.

    Powered by ihonker.com

    Copyright © 2015-现在.

  • 返回顶部